§ 30-2339 — Requirement that devisee survive testator by one hundred twenty hours

Nebraska·Ch. 30 Decedents' Estates; Protection of Persons and Property
A devisee who does not survive the testator by one hundred twenty hours is treated as if he predeceased the testator, unless the will of the testator contains some language dealing explicitly with simultaneous deaths or deaths in a common disaster, or requiring that the devisee survive the testator or survive the testator for a stated period in order to take under the will.

Legislative History

Source: Laws 1974, LB 354, § 61, UPC § 2-601.
